When the PickPath optimizer at the Dunmore fulfillment site fails to produce a pick list within its 90-second SLA, the floor falls back to manual routing, which roughly doubles pick times. First, check the solver queue depth dashboard and confirm inputs from the inventory snapshot service are fresh. If the queue is healthy but solutions still time out, page the optimization on-call rotation. For non-urgent anomalies, such as degraded route quality, write up your observations and send them to the team's shared inbox.

billing contact of tahaf-kafop = istwyn_fraox@norvaworks.corp

/*
 * Relevance tuning client — Searchwell internal service.
 * Release notes for the manager: this build adjusts field boosts
 * (title 2.4, synonyms 1.1) per the Harlowe tuning experiments,
 * and pins the analyzer version so rollbacks stay deterministic.
 * Do not ship without re-running the golden-query suite; drift
 * above 3% blocks release. The client below authenticates against
 * the tuning API using the key that follows.
 */

service key, tadup-tahog: zpat7_wB1tnEL

Building Access: Roof Terrace Door (Calloway Wing)

Welcome to Fenbrook House. The roof-terrace door on level 6 has a known tendency to jam, especially in damp weather. Do not force it; pull the handle upward slightly while pushing, and it should release. If it still sticks, report it to facilities rather than propping it open, as this triggers the alarm after ninety seconds. The keypad beside the door overrides the badge reader when the reader misbehaves; enter the following code.

staff pass of kawip-hawef = bdg-QLP-2

Subject: On-call heads-up — Orchardly catalog cache. Welcome aboard. The main gotcha: catalog price updates invalidate by SKU, but bundle pages cache composite keys, so a stale bundle can outlive its parts. If support reports wrong bundle prices, purge the composite namespace first. We'll cover this at the weekly sync; the invalidation playbook is on this internal page.

wiki page, yagef-tawif: https://sentry.lumicdata.local/view/merge_requests/pipeline/merge_requests/e08f7f35c80b5755